I suspect this is because the dead_end gem - which is the syntax_suggest repo - has been integrated with Ruby 3.2. At the very least it's not clear to me what is expected to happen if you include that gem while running Ruby 3.2 or later. There is an issue against the syntax_suggest repo which seems to indicate that you no longer need to include the gem but it doesn't say what will happen when you do. The stacktrace above does point to some of the require_relative overrides going on in that gem.
